In 2011, the Hudson community unanimously accepted a referendum to alter the project name from Hudson to Jenkins, resulting within the creation of the primary “Jenkins” project. Hudson was later donated to the Eclipse Basis and is no longer being labored on. Jenkins development is at present administered as an open-source project underneath https://www.globalcloudteam.com/ the direction of the CD Basis, a Linux Foundation initiative.

Jenkins could also be operated as a server on varied working techniques, together with Windows, macOS, Unix variations, and, most notably, Linux. It also runs on the Oracle JRE or OpenJDK and requires a Java 8 virtual machine or higher.

The pipeline configuration is saved in a plain text file known as the Jenkinsfile. Using a curly bracket syntax akin to JSON, the Jenkinsfile outlines the steps, every declared as commands with particular parameters enclosed in curly brackets. As Soon As the Jenkins server reads the Jenkinsfile, it carries out the outlined commands, efficiently moving the code by way of the pipeline, from dedicated source code to manufacturing runtime.
